Gaza children protest Halabi's detention

PIC reported:

Dozens of Palestinian children and activists rallied in the blockaded Gaza Strip on Sunday in protest at Israel’s abduction of Mohammad al- Halabi, manager of the World Vision charity operations in Gaza.

The rally-goers gathered outside the World Vision headquarters in Gaza City, lifting the pictures of activist al-Halabi.

Participants in the vigil called for the immediate release of al-Halabi, calling him “humanity’s savior.”

Al-Halabi, 38, was arrested by the Israeli occupation forces on May 15 while crossing the Beit Hanoun border-crossing into the enclave.

The Israeli intelligence service Shabak accused him of diverting cash to the Palestinian Resistance Movement Hamas.

However, both Hamas and the World Vision Charity denied Israeli allegations that al-Halabi passed millions of dollars to the group.
